Introduced Bill for transparency regarding AI-generated content (HB 6466)

On 21 November 2023, the Bill for transparency regarding Artificial Intelligence (AI) generated content (AI Labeling Act/HB 6466) was introduced in the United States Senate. The Bill requires developers of generative AI systems to include a disclosure that identifies AI-generated content and AI chatbots. Furthermore, it aims to prevent the publication of content by imposing obligations on developers of generative AI systems. In addition, the Bill seeks to establish a working group with the National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) and other relevant federal agencies to develop a framework. The Framework shall include technical standards to support platforms, guidelines for the implementation, and recommendations for detection practices for non-audiovisual AI-generated content.
